Deposit: £605.7686:Tb11,Tenancy Information
At Wards Property, we believe in being open and transparent about any costs linked to your tenancy â so there are no surprises.
When youâve found the right property, weâll give you a Tenancy Application Form This will clearly explain:
The next steps in your applicationAny permitted payments before you sign your Tenancy AgreementAny possible charges during or after your tenancyThe agreed rent and deposit amount
Below is our guide to permitted payments under the Tenant Fees Act 2019 If youâd like a personalised breakdown for a specific property, just ask a member of our team.
Holding Deposit â One weekâs rent
This reserves the property for you.
We can only keep this if:
You (or your guarantor) withdraw from the tenancyYou fail a Right to Rent checkYou provide false or misleading informationYou donât sign the tenancy agreement (and/or guarantor agreement) within 15 calendar days, or any other agreed deadline
Security Deposit
If rent is under £50,000 per year â Five weeksâ rentIf rent is £50,000 or more per year â Six weeksâ rent
This covers damages or defaults during the tenancy. Deposits are protected in line with legal requirements.
Unpaid Rent
Interest is charged at 3% above the Bank of England Base Rate, starting 14 days after rent is due, until payment is made.
Lost Keys or Security Devices
Youâll be charged the actual cost of replacement.
If locks need changing, costs will include the locksmith, new lock, and keys for all parties.
If extra time is required, we charge £15 per hour (inc. VAT) for our time in arranging this.
Changes to Your Tenancy Agreement (at your request) â £50 (inc. VAT)
This covers landlord approval, preparation, and signing of updated legal documents.
Change of Tenant (at your request) â £50 (inc. VAT) or the actual cost if higher
This covers landlord approval, referencing, Right to Rent checks, deposit updates, and new legal documents.
Ending Your Tenancy Early (at your request)
If you leave before your contract ends, youâll be responsible for:
The landlordâs re-letting costsThe rent until a new tenancy starts
These costs will never be more than the total rent remaining on your agreement.
